## Digest Scheduler — Onboarding Notes

Quick context for your review: the Nightpost digest scheduler batches user notifications into a single email per configured window (hourly, daily, weekly). Schedules live in one table, and a worker sweeps it every five minutes — no per-user crons, thankfully. Unsubscribes take effect at the next sweep. To inspect the schedule table, connect with the following.

replica DSN, kajep-yahag: mssql://praok_svc:iF@db-8d68.plorvaio.local:5432/eliion

When an export job in Lanternfall fails, the scheduler retries it three times with exponential backoff before marking it dead-lettered. Dead-lettered exports are held for 14 days in the quarantine bucket, after which they are purged. Security reviewers should note that retry payloads are re-encrypted on each attempt, so no plaintext persists between retries. Manual replays require operator approval via the Drystone console. To unlock the replay console during an audit, you will need the recovery passphrase below.

vault phrase of taweg-kafof = oliax-zorael

### Step 4: Ship the Relevance Tuning Notes (Querella)

Okay, almost there. The search relevance tuning notes get bundled into the deploy artifact so the ranking service can hot-load boost weights without a restart. Copy `tuning-notes.yaml` into the release folder, then open the service's `.env` and confirm QUERELLA_BOOST_PROFILE points at the new file. The notes sync uploader also needs its credential in that same env file, set on the line right after this step.

env line for fafof-fahag: LEDGER_TOKEN5=f8790

Heads up, security folks — this page covers how we attest the artifacts used in the Quellhaven user-profile sharding rollout. Each shard-splitter binary is built hermetically on the Ostbridge farm, and the manifest records compiler flags, source revision, and the shard-map checksum. Nothing gets promoted to staging without a signed attestation from the release bot. If you're auditing the migration, start by matching the manifest hash against the deploy log. The provenance token for the current rollout build appears directly below.

session token of tajog-fahaf = htk21_4ae55819f45410afcb307